Wounds &bruises upon the Head and face of the deced, and that he
bled very much Deponent says that Deced was
immediately carried to the Westminster Infirmary , Depent
following him, says that she there Stripped deced and put
him into Bed, and that a Surgeon attempted to bleed him
but he did not bleed much and in about two hours died
Says she did not see deced fall, but was informed that he
fell out at the Window of her Room, which she verily believes
was the occasion of his Death
